bool CallExpr::IsEmptyHook() const {
if ( func->Tag() != EXPR_NAME )
return false;
auto func_id = func->AsNameExpr()->IdPtr();
auto func_val = func_id->GetVal();
if ( ! func_val || ! func_id->IsGlobal() )
return false;
if ( func_id->GetType()->AsFuncType()->Flavor() != FUNC_FLAVOR_HOOK )
return false;
return ! func_val->AsFuncVal()->Get()->HasBodies();
}
